    I'm old-school when it comes to finding fish. No gadgets here. Only thing running off the battery is my little old Minn-Kota. If they ain't in their usual haunts, I'll troll around some other likely areas and eventually I find them. When I go to a new lake, I start with a topo map, then maybe talk to a few locals and generally can find-em.
